gotimer

Go Version Go Reference License

一个轻量的 Go 周期定时任务库,用于按固定间隔重复执行函数。 A lightweight Go timer library for running functions repeatedly at a fixed interval.

目录 / Table of Contents

功能特性 / Features

  • 基于 time.Ticker 的周期任务调度
  • 支持动态添加任务
  • 支持按任务 ID 移除任务
  • 支持一键清空全部任务
  • 内置 panic 捕获,避免单个任务异常导致进程崩溃
  • 使用 UUID 作为任务唯一标识
  • Built on time.Ticker for periodic scheduling
  • Add, remove, and clear jobs at runtime
  • Panic recovery for safer task execution
  • UUID-based job identifiers

安装 / Installation

go get github.com/felix-186/gotimer

快速开始 / Quick Start

package main

import (
	"fmt"
	"time"

	"github.com/felix-186/gotimer"
)

func main() {
	timer := gotimer.NewTimer()

	jobID := timer.AddFunc(time.Second, func() {
		fmt.Println("tick:", time.Now().Format("2006-01-02 15:04:05"))
	})

	time.Sleep(5 * time.Second)
	timer.Remove(jobID)

	timer.Clear()
}

API

NewTimer() *Timer

创建一个新的定时器实例。 Create a new timer instance.

(*Timer) AddFunc(duration time.Duration, cmd func()) string

添加一个周期任务,并返回任务 ID。 Add a periodic job and return its job ID.

Parameters:

  • duration: 任务执行间隔 / execution interval
  • cmd: 到期时执行的函数 / callback to run

Returns:

  • string: 任务唯一 ID / unique job ID

(*Timer) Remove(id string)

根据任务 ID 移除并停止指定任务。 Remove and stop a job by ID.

(*Timer) Clear()

停止并清空当前定时器中的所有任务。 Stop and clear all registered jobs.

工作机制 / How It Works

每个任务内部维护一个独立的 time.Ticker 和取消上下文:

  • 到达设定间隔后执行一次回调函数
  • 调用 Remove 时停止单个任务
  • 调用 Clear 时停止全部任务
  • 若任务执行过程中发生 panic,库会捕获并记录日志

Each job owns its own time.Ticker and cancellation context:

  • The callback runs on every tick
  • Remove stops a single job
  • Clear stops all jobs
  • Panics are recovered and logged internally

日志与异常处理 / Logging and Panic Recovery

任务执行时使用 log/slog 输出运行日志。

当任务函数发生 panic 时,库会在内部恢复异常并记录错误信息,避免影响其他任务继续运行。

The library uses log/slog for runtime logging. If a job panics, the panic is recovered internally and logged so that other jobs can continue running.

注意事项 / Notes

  • 当前任务调度为固定周期触发

  • 若任务执行时间长于调度间隔,后续 tick 可能被延迟

  • Clear() 会停止所有已注册任务,适合在程序退出前统一释放资源

  • Scheduling is interval-based

  • If a job runs longer than its interval, subsequent ticks may be delayed

  • Clear() is useful for graceful shutdown and resource cleanup

性能 / Performance

当前环境下的一组示例 benchmark 结果:

BenchmarkTimerAddFunc-16    1129238      1064 ns/op    801 B/op    13 allocs/op
BenchmarkTimerRemove-16     1000000      1044 ns/op    800 B/op    13 allocs/op
BenchmarkJobDo-16         499988125     2.466 ns/op      0 B/op     0 allocs/op

These numbers are sample results from the current local environment and should be treated as a reference rather than a strict guarantee.
